Bhel bags order from Railways for solar power plant
Bhel has bagged one more order of 2 MW roof top SPV systems at Diesel Locomotive Modernisation Works (DMW), Patiala, the company said in a statement.
The contract agreement was signed between Bhel and Indian Railways Organisation for Alternate Fuels (IROAF).
It envisages design, supply, installation, testing and commissioning of grid connected roof top solar photo voltaic power plant with all electrical and associated equipment including civil works, Bhel said.
It also includes operations and maintenance for 5 years.
